Output e579371e1ca6dd11c28939b7c81ef1001955d4bd42ae24b2a01e3f9df7224123:0

value
1531345050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f61e608e7acf6984f82b7dd0a34f4e8fc6c69db OP_EQUAL
address
9xDQWb1YHfWJGrcXaFZdEQTUK6t5wpLpLP
transaction
e579371e1ca6dd11c28939b7c81ef1001955d4bd42ae24b2a01e3f9df7224123